طراحی سایت چیست؟
طراحی سایت (web design) به معنای تلاش جهت ایجاد یک پایگاه اینترنتی برای ارائه خدمات، اطلاعرسانی یا فروش محصولات است. طراحی سایت پروسهای میباشد که از تولید محتوا، لایهسازی صفحات وب، طراحی گرافیکی و رعایت اصول سئو تشکیل شده است.
اگر میخواهید سایت قدرتمندی ایجاد کنید که با استفاده از آن خدمات یا هر چیز دیگری را به صفحه اول گوگل بیاورید، باید تمام اصول ظاهری و فنی سایت را رعایت کنید.
اگر بخواهیم تعریف سادهتری از طراحی سایت داشته باشیم، باید بگوییم طراحی سایت به معنای ساخت وبسایت یا بهینهسازی و ریدیزاین (redesign) یک سایت قدیمی در بستر اینترنت است.

طراحی سایت چیست؟
وظایف طراح سایت
طراح سایت با توجه به اینکه در چه پروسهای از طراحی سایت درگیر است، وظایف مختلفی دارد. بهطورکلی در راهاندازی و طراحی سایت به دو فرد یا دو تیم برای طراحی back-end و front-end نیاز است.
متخصص back-end کسی است که مسئولیت نوشتن کدهای مختلف برای ایجاد ساختار اصلی سایت را به عهده دارد. این کدها از نظر بازدیدکنندگان سایت پنهان است و وظیفه عملکرد و راهاندازی سایت را به عهده دارد.
متخصص front-end کسی است که از زبانهای برنامهنویسی مانند python، PHP و ASP استفاده میکند. در بحث طراحی front-end هر کاری که انجام میشود، برای بهتر کردن ویژگیهای دیداری سایت میباشد.
برای توسعه ظاهر سایت به کدنویسی نیاز است که نوشتن این کدها با زبانهایی مانند CSS، html و JavaScript انجام میشود.
ابزارهای طراحی سایت
بهتر است با چند نرمافزار طراحی سایت آشنا شوید.
1- Adobe Photoshop
فتوشاپ یکی از بهترین نرمافزارهای ویرایش عکس و کار با تصاویر است که نهتنها برای طراحی سایت، بلکه برای بسیاری از کارهای مربوط به گرافیک و طراحی، به میزان زیادی مورداستفاده قرار میگیرد. نرمافزار فتوشاپ دارای ابزارهای زیادی میباشد که با توجه به نیاز خود، میتوان از آن برای ویرایش یا طراحی تصاویر استفاده کرد.
در طراحی سایت، از نرمافزار فتوشاپ میتوان برای اضافه نمودن متن به عکس، تغییر رنگ و ویرایش تصاویر، طراحی و اجرای فایلهای متحرک، تغییر اندازه عکسها برای برقراری تناسب آن با طراحی، کاهش حجم عکسها با کمترین تأثیر در کیفیت آن و ترکیب چندین عکس در کنار یکدیگر استفاده کرد.
2- Visual Studio
Visual Studio اصلیترین برنامه برای تولید نرمافزارهای تحت ویندوز به شمار میرود که از آن برای نوشتن برنامههای وب استفاده میشود.
یکی از قویترین نرمافزارها برای طراحی سایتهای حرفهای Visual Studio است که متعلق به کمپانی مایکروسافت میباشد. از این برنامه برای کدنویسیهای مربوط به پایگاه داده با استفاده از زبان asp.net و طراحی سایت استفاده میشود.

Visual Studio
3- Adobe Dreamweaver
نرمافزار Adobe Dreamweaver برای اولین بار توسط شرکت ماکرومویا عرضه شد. مدتی بعد این شرکت توسط Adobe که سازنده نرمافزار فتوشاپ است، خریداری شد و Dreamweaver تبدیل به یکی دیگر از محصولات Adobe گردید.
Dreamweaver بهترین نرمافزار طراحی سایت میباشد. زمانی که برنامهنویسان و طراحان سایت ابزارهای دیگری در اختیار نداشتند، این نرمافزار تنها نرمافزاری بود که میتوانستند از آن بهصورت کاربردی استفاده کنند.
4- Bluefish
از نرمافزار Bluefish برای طراحی مجدد سایت و بازنویسی سایت استفاده میشود. بلوفیش برای سیستمعاملهای مختلف طراحی شده است و نسبت به نرمافزارهای همنوع خود سبک و از لحاظ یادگیری ساده میباشد.
5- CoffeeCup HTML Editor
این نرمافزار نسخه جذابتر Dreamweaver میباشد که محیط گرافیکی زیبایی دارد و کار با آن ساده است.
6- Adobe Fireworks
نرمافزار Adobe Fireworks جایگزین خوبی برای فتوشاپ میباشد که با استفاده از آن میتوان تصاویر کمحجم و باکیفیت و همچنین وکتورهای زیبا خلق کرد.

Adobe Fireworks
انواع طراحی سایت
سایتها به چند دسته تقسیم میشوند که هریک طراحی خاص خود را میطلبد.
-
سایتهای ثابت
این سایتها طوری طراحی میشوند که اطلاعات موردنیاز بهطور کامل در آن قرار داده میشود. برای ایجاد تغییر در سایت باید با کدنویسی سایت آشنا باشید.
اغلب این سایتها با html طراحی میشوند که دارای حجم بسیار کم کدنویسی هستند و سرعت بارگذاری بالایی دارند.
کاهش حجم کد بهوسیله موتورهای جستوجو باعث خواناتر شدن سایت میشود. همچنین سایتهای ثابت، قیمت پایین و امنیت بیشتری نسبت به دیگر سایتها دارند.
سایتهای ثابت توسط صاحبان و مدیران سایت قابلتغییر نیستند و امکان بهروزرسانی زودهنگام آنها وجود ندارد. این سایتها برای مواردی استفاده میشوند که یک یا دو مرتبه در سال به تغییر محتوا نیاز دارند.
-
سایتهای پویا
برعکس سایتهای ثابت، دسترسی به بخش مدیریتی سایتهای پویا آزاد میباشد و صاحبان آن در هر لحظه میتوانند محتوای سایت را تغییر دهند.
اغلب سایتهای پویا به زبانهای asp، php و asp.net نوشته میشوند و از زبانهایی مانند css و silver light برای افزودن قابلیتهای بیشتر به آنها استفاده میشود.
قالب اصلی سایتهای پویا توسط طراح نوشته میشود و مدیر سایت اقدام به تولید محتوای موردنظر برای سایت میکند.
مزیت اصلی سایتهای پویا این است که محدودیتی برای ایجاد، تغییر و حذف مطلب و … ندارد. برای ساخت سایت پویا میتوان با استفاده از زبانهای پیشرفته طراحی سایت، امکاناتی از جمله فرمها، صفحات هوشمند و … را به آنها اضافه کرد.

سایتهای پویا
-
پورتالها
پورتالها سایتهای کاملی هستند و چندین هدف را در یک سایت دنبال میکنند. به این منظور، چند سایت پویا برای رسیدن به اهدافی خاص در کنار یکدیگر قرار میگیرند.
-
سایتهای فلش
سایتهای فلش از نوع نیمهپویا و ایستا هستند که توسط نرمافزارهای خاصی طراحی میشوند. سایتهای فلش ثابت هستند و توسط طراح سایت ایجاد میشوند و قابلتغییر نخواهند بود.
مزیت سایتهای فلش، انیمیشنهای جذاب و گرافیک زیبای آنها است. از معایب آن میتوان بهسرعت بارگذاری پایین و خوانده نشدن توسط موتورهای جستوجو اشاره کرد.
هدف از طراحی سایت
با توجه به اینکه سایتها انواع مختلفی دارند، ممکن است هدف یک فرد از طراحی سایت با هدف فرد دیگر متفاوت باشد. امروزه اغلب برای هر هدفی سایتی طراحی میشود تا بهعنوان فضایی برای فروش، پایگاه اطلاعرسانی یا هر منظور دیگری مورداستفاده قرار بگیرد. با یک جستوجوی ساده میتوانید تعداد زیادی از وبسایتهای تجاری، خبری و … را که فعال هستند، رؤیت کنید. گروههایی هستند که از بهینهسازی، هدفگذاری سئو و اصول طراحی سایت پیروی کردهاند تا اطلاعات سایت خود را به بازدیدکنندگان نمایش دهند.

هدف از طراحی سایت
مزیت طراحی سایت برای کسبوکارها
طراحی سایت برای کسبوکارها مزایای قابلتوجهی دارد که در ادامه درباره آن صحبت میکنیم.
-
سهولت دسترسی
امروزه زندگی افراد پر از مشغله است و به دنبال راهحلی آسان در حوزههای مختلف زندگی خود هستند. خرید آنلاین بهجای رفتن به بازار، راحتترین روش خرید میباشد.
با توجه به قوانین و مقررات امنیتی که وجود دارد، اعتماد افراد به خرید آنلاین افزایش یافته است که این امر میتواند موجب افزایش درآمد و رونق کسبوکار آنلاین شود.
-
کاهش هزینه
بهترین راه برای رشد کسبوکار این است که هزینهها را کاهش دهید و به سمت رشد حرکت کنید.
کاهش هزینه را میتوان یکی از مزیتهای طراحی سایت برای کسبوکارها در نظر گرفت. بهترین روش برای کاهش هزینهها وجود وبسایت است.
هزینه اجرا و نگهداری وبسایت معمولاً چند میلیون میباشد. بازاریابی مناسب سایت باعث رشد مداوم کسبوکار میشود. اگر وبسایت بهدرستی طراحی شود و توسعه یابد، بازدیدکننده به مشتری تبدیل خواهد شد.
-
بازاریابی گسترده
بازاریابی برای سایت مقرونبهصرفهتر و سادهتر از هر نوع بازاریابی دیگر میباشد. برای تبلیغ سایت خود میتوانید از سئوی سایت بهره ببرید که هم مؤثر است و هم امکان سنجش آن وجود دارد.
در بازاریابی آنلاین، مزیت طراحی سایت برای کسبوکارها پررنگتر از بقیه موارد است و تمام مزایای دیگر را پوشش میدهد.
-
بهروز بودن اطلاعات
در دنیای واقعی، برای اینکه مشتریان خود را از فروشهای ویژه و پیشنهادات خود مطلع کنید، از ابزارهای محیطی مانند بیلبوردها، تابلوها و … استفاده میکنید. در رابطه با سایت میتوانید اطلاعات را بهراحتی بهروز کنید و پیشنهادات خود را هرزمان که خواستید، به مشتریان نشان دهید و از این طریق فروش خود را افزایش دهید.

بهروز بودن اطلاعات
-
ارائه خدمات بهتر
اگر محصولی را میفروشید و قصد دارید مزایای محصول را به مشتری بگویید، مقالات مربوط به آن را در سایت آپلود کنید و خدمات لازم را به مشتریان ارائه دهید. همچنین میتوانید یک بخش پرسش و پاسخ داشته باشید تا توضیحات لازم را به مشتریان ارائه دهید.
-
مزایای مادامالعمر
وبسایتها نتایج مادامالعمری دارند؛ به این معنی که شما برای تبلیغات خارجی متناسب با هزینههایی که پرداخت میکنید، مدت زمان محدودی در اختیار دارید. اما سایت همواره وجود دارد و مزایای مادامالعمری خواهد داشت.
مراحل طراحی سایت
طراحی سایت به چهار مرحله اصلی تقسیم میشود:
مرحله اول: طراحی وایرفریم (wireframe)
در ابتدا با توجه به نیاز مشتری و نوع سایت، یک نمای کلی از سایت را طراحی کنید. این نما شامل یک نقشه کلی از تعیین جایگاه، صفحات سایت و چیدمان المانهای مختلف است.
مرحله دوم: طراحی گرافیکی سایت
پس از مشخص شدن محل قرارگیری عناصر سایت، نوبت طراحی گرافیکی سایت میباشد. در مرحله طراحی گرافیکی سایت، با استفاده از نرمافزارهای مخصوص، رنگبندی متناسب با نوع کسبوکار اینترنتی خود را انتخاب و طراحی کنید.
مرحله سوم: کدنویسی و برنامهنویسی
با توجه به نیاز مشتری و طراحی سایت، در این مرحله میتوان از روشهای مختلفی برای مدیریت سایت استفاده کرد.
از بهترین سیستمهای مدیریت محتوا میتوان وردپرس را نام برد. همچنین میتوانید یک فریمورک اختصاصی برای برنامهنویسی خود طراحی کنید. تصمیمگیری برای کدنویسی و برنامهنویسی به نظر مشتری و بودجه او بستگی دارد.
مرحله چهارم: راهاندازی سایت
در مرحله راهاندازی سایت، پس از تهیههاست، نام دامنه مناسب سایت را پیکربندی کنید و در دسترس عموم قرار دهید.

راهاندازی سایت
مشاغل مرتبط با طراحی سایت
برای اینکه سایت به موفقیت برسد و در نتایج موتور جستوجو بدرخشد، علاوه بر طراحان سایت، افراد زیادی باید درگیر توسعه و نگهداری از آن باشند. در ادامه بهصورت فهرستگونه مشاغل و تخصصهای مرتبط با راهاندازی و نگهداری سایت را شرح خواهیم داد.
- به یک گرافیست نیاز دارید تا لیاوت و لوگوی مناسبی برای شما طراحی کند.
- باید با یک متخصص دیجیتال مارکتینگ همکاری کنید تا به شما بگوید چه استراتژیهایی به کار ببرید و با استفاده از تکنیکهای بازاریابی آنلاین، مؤثرترین ترافیک را به سایت خود هدایت کنید.
- به متخصص کپی رایتینگ نیاز دارید تا برای ایجاد محتوای مناسب و پیگیری هدف سئو به شما کمک کند.
- طراح رابط کاربری یکی دیگر از مشاغل مرتبط با طراحی و نگهداری از سایت است. این فرد به شما کمک میکند تا معماری اطلاعات، طراحی و المانهای ظاهری سایت را بهبود بخشید.
هزینه طراحی سایت چگونه برآورد میشود؟
عوامل زیادی بر هزینه طراحی سایت تأثیرگذار هستند که در زیر به برخی از آنها اشاره خواهیم کرد.
-
دامنه سایت
دامنه یا آدرس سایت میتواند با پسوندهای مختلفی مانند ir، com و … ثبت شود. دامنهها هزینه متفاوتی دارند. اولین موردی که باید به آن توجه شود، نام دامنه است.
دامنه یا آدرس سایت بهصورت ماهانه یا سالانه اجاره داده میشود و تا زمانی که هزینه آن را پرداخت کنید، متعلق به شما خواهد بود.
-
هزینه هاست
هاست کامپیوتری میباشد که در طول شبانهروز به اینترنت متصل است. زمانی که سایت رویهاست قرار میگیرد، از همهجا قابلدسترس است.
اینکه سایت شما بر روی چه هاستی قرار بگیرد و در ایران باشد یا در کشورهای دیگر، بر روی هزینهها تأثیرگذار است.
هر کس در هر لحظه از شبانهروز با وارد کردن آدرس سایت میتواند به محتوای ارائهشده دسترسی پیدا کند. بنابراین هاست قابلاعتماد از اهمیت زیادی برخوردار است و هزینه آن بهصورت ماهیانه یا سالیانه محاسبه میشود.
-
هزینه طراحی سایت
بهطورکلی طراحی سایت با استفاده از کدنویسی و سیستمهای آماده انجام میشود. انتخاب هر کدام از این روشها به هدف شما و کسبوکارتان بستگی دارد. عواملی مانند تکنیک طراحی، امنیت طراحی، مهارت طراح و … در تعیین قیمت طراحی سایت مؤثر میباشد.
-
آموزش
هنگامی که سایت خود را از تیم طراحی تحویل میگیرید، برای مدیریت آن به دوره آموزشی نیاز دارید. باید آموزشهای لازم را دریافت کنید تا بتوانید محصولات قبلی را بهروزرسانی کنید و محصولات جدید را وارد کنید. در نتیجه، این دورههای آموزشی بر هزینههای سایت تأثیر میگذارد.

آموزش
-
هزینه تولید محتوا
در موفقیت یک سایت، تولید محتوا اهمیت زیادی دارد. سایتی که بدون محتوای جدید باشد و سئو نشده باشد، نمیتواند رتبه خوبی از گوگل دریافت کند.
قیمتگذاری تولید محتوا با توجه به سابقه کارشناس تولید محتوا و تواناییهای او متفاوت است.
روشهای طراحی سایت
فرایند طراحی سایت با استفاده از زبان برنامهنویسی و بدون استفاده از آن انجام میشود.
-
ساخت و طراحی سایت با استفاده از زبان برنامهنویسی
در این روش، طراح سایت با استفاده از نرمافزارهای متعدد، مانند (Dreamweaver، NetObjects، KompoZer، RapidWeaver) و دانش برنامهنویسی خودش صفحات سایت را بهصورت دینامیک یا استاتیک طراحی میکند.
-
طراحی سایت بدون استفاده از زبان برنامهنویسی
در این روش، بدون اینکه دانشی در برنامهنویسی داشته باشید، با استفاده از تعدادی نرمافزار تولید محتوای تحت وب مانند WordPress و Joomla میتوانید صفحات وبسایت خود را تولید و طراحی کنید.